As a top-ranking model in the latest lineup, the 2021 Jeep Grand Cherokee Summit is available with two powertrain options. Both come with an 8-speed automatic transmission and a 4x4 drivetrain.
The first is the standard 3.6-litre V6 with VVT and ESS technology. Pushing out 293 hp and 260 lb-ft of torque, it can tow up to 1,587 kgs (3,500 lbs). You can also expect to get around 12.4 L/100 km in the city (19 mpg) and 9.0 L/100 km on the highway (26 mpg).

The other version is a massive 5.7-litre HEMI V8 with VVT and a multi-displacement system. Generating 360 hp and 390 lb-ft of torque, this model can pull 2,812 kgs (6,200 lbs). This is ideal if you plan on bringing a camper on your next road trip. As for the fuel economy, it gets about 16.8 L/100 km in the city (14 mpg) and 10.7 L/100 km on the highway (22 mpg).
